The Bays at Frisco Breaks Ground


The Bays at Frisco, an 18-acre golf resort between PGA Parkway and U.S. Highway 380, broke ground recently. Partnering with California-based TaylorMade, The Bays at Frisco is a four-story, 100,000-square-foot golf lab and suites equipped with real golf equipment and technology, restaurant and bar and onsite boutique hotel.

The Bays will be a unique social and entertainment hub that blends the traditional sport with modern technology and offers great views of PGA Frisco. At the TaylorMade exclusive club-fitting experience, only the third TaylorMade fitting center in the nation, guests can watch their new custom clubs as they are crafted onsite. The Bays guests will have full access to TaylorMade clubs and use true TaylorMade balls.

"The rise of golf post-pandemic has soared as more flock to the outdoors for exercise, so we wanted to create an entertainment venue that includes various professional golf brands that will draw golfers of all levels over and over again," said James Meese, Founder of The Bays. "The makeup of golfers has changed and grown into new cultures, and we are inspired to serve all audiences of North Texas who take an interest in golf."

Leadership from The Bays, TaylorMade and the City of Frisco recently celebrated the official start of construction on The Bays in Frisco. Additionally, Parker and Pierceson Coody, PGA Tour players from North Texas, were also in attendance to hit the official first drives at The Bays.

The Bays is designed to generate an immersive golf experience where all ages and levels, from avid golfers to novices, are transported into a golfer's paradise and presented with the opportunity to play across deluxe golf hitting bays and a spacious 25,000-square-foot putting green with an extensive bar. Guests can make the restaurant itself a destination with a 100-foot-wide video wall along with upscale menu options prepared by the restaurant's professional chef. A 12,000-square-foot private membership club will be on the third and fourth floors. There will also be dedicated space for corporate suites, events and partnerships.

"Golf, whether you do well that day or not, is truly about the experience and the memories made with your friends, and that is the exact idea of The Bays at Frisco," said J.R. Smith, two-time NBA champion and investment partner with The Bays. "James has created a great concept with luxury golf experiences and hospitality at The Bays in Frisco, and once it opens, it will definitely become my home away from home."

The Bays will feature a boutique, 19-key hotel on the third and fourth floors with suites, each with its own private hitting bay, and one- and two-bedroom rooms. Executive suites will be available for corporate events or office retreats. The boutique hotel will feature a rooftop pool with cabanas for guests.

"Breaking ground on The Bays with a TaylorMade experience will set this golf experience above any other consumer golf experience currently available," Meese said. "Having TaylorMade's golf equipment leadership and fitting expertise directly available to players allows The Bays to give guests a true Tour experience. TaylorMade and The Bays will be a great marriage in Frisco, the new modern home of golf."

The Bays chose the city of Frisco as the site for its first location, as it has become an entertainment and golf center. PGA Frisco has opened and expanded over the past two years, including the PGA of America headquarters, two new 18-hole championship courses, a 510-room Omni Resort, a 30-acre practice facility, a performance center and a modern clubhouse.

The Bays is set to open in late 2025.
